Purpose-built for heavy-duty applications, this Nylon stock sheet boasts exceptional durability and resistance to wear and corrosion, making it ideal for demanding plumbing and janitorial tasks. Measuring a substantial 0.627 inches thick, with a generous 36-inch length and 33-inch width, it provides ample material for custom fabrication. Nylon's inherent properties include excellent tensile strength, low coefficient of friction, and high impact resistance, ensuring reliable performance in harsh chemical and mechanical conditions. This material is a superior choice for fabricating custom components, protective barriers, and structural elements where longevity and robustness are paramount.
